Which of the following devices is primarily used to interrupt excessive current flow?

A circuit breaker is primarily used to interrupt excessive current flow to protect electrical circuits from damage caused by overloads or short circuits. When the current exceeds the rated capacity of the breaker, it automatically trips, breaking the circuit and stopping the flow of current. This prevents overheating, potential fires, and equipment damage, maintaining safety in electrical installations.

In contrast, a relay is typically used for switching operations or controlling circuits rather than protecting against excessive current. A transformer is designed to change the voltage levels in an electrical circuit and is not involved in interrupting current flow. A capacitor is used for storing electrical energy and cannot interrupt current flow; rather, it functions in power factor correction and energy storage applications. Therefore, the circuit breaker is the correct choice, as its main function is to provide overcurrent protection.
